Thinking that AI has a "spirit" in the traditional dualistic sense (a non-physical essence), is category error. The Premise: "AI shows empathy and wisdom, therefore it has a soul". The Fault: You are confusing Output with Ontology. The Gear: A calculator doesn't "know" math; it is the math. An AI doesn't "feel" spirituality; it simulates the linguistic markers of spirituality so perfectly that your own empathy-circuits are hijacked. The "spirit" is a projection from the user into the black box. The Second-Order Effect: The Death of the Human Priest. The real disruption isn't whether AI has a soul, but what happens to human spiritual authority. For millennia, the "divine" was mediated by priests because they had access to the "word" (the books). Now, a Finn in Lollinjärvi can have a more profound, personalized, and "enlightened" philosophical dialogue with a 405B parameter model than with any local clergyman. When the "divine" becomes a commodity—when "enlightenment" is a prompt away—the social structures built around spiritual scarcity will collapse. We aren't looking at a new religion; we're looking at the democratization of the numinous.
